Waterfall and Natural Arch

This short, easy hike includes a good view of a 60 foot waterfall as well as a natural arch. The hike is approximately 1.5 miles one way and can be done in about an hour. There may be very little water coming over the falls in late summer and fall but the hike is still worthwhile. 

There is also the Slave Falls loop trail that you can do if you would like to make it a longer hike. However, to the falls and back, I would rate as easy. 

Needle Arch is an easy .2 mile hike from the trail leading to Slave Falls. You can reach it in about five minutes. Climbing on the arch is prohibited but it is worth checking out. 

GPS: Put in Fork Ridge Road, Jamestown, TN 

You will park at the Sawmill Trailhead
